Transaction 866525bbe17ade39b596fa361bc8ce73c64e9af0a12b0a53ad2e24abcac49873

1 Input
2 Outputs
  • 866525bbe17ade39b596fa361bc8ce73c64e9af0a12b0a53ad2e24abcac49873:0
  • value  501670
    address  1Huss63xPBuCyZakWgEqA62yLGqYj5eZ1r
  • 866525bbe17ade39b596fa361bc8ce73c64e9af0a12b0a53ad2e24abcac49873:1
  • value  485796
    address  3Lvr7wdH3VhP25o9GcExzrdsQ4WH84meT9